The Rise of Esports Tournaments

Esports tournaments have evolved into highly anticipated global events, drawing millions of viewers each year. Technological advancements and increased internet accessibility have fueled this rapid growth. For example, in 2010, few could predict the magnitude of audiences reached today. Games like:

  • League of Legends
  • Counter-Strike: Global Offensive

attract massive fan bases and viewership, with League Championship matches garnering 44 million peak concurrent views in 2022.

Industry investments are significant, as brands and sponsors recognize the marketing potential within esports. Tournament prize pools now exceed totals once unimaginable. The International, a Dota 2 event, reached over $40 million in prize money in 2021, showing escalating enthusiasm and financial backing.

Live stre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ube have transformed accessibility, offering immediate experiences for global fans. These platforms also enable interactivity through chat functions, enhancing community connections. With such infrastructure, esports stands poised for sustained growth in global cultures, industries, and entertainment.

The International

The International stands as a premier event in the esports calendar. Featuring Dota 2, it draws the best teams globally to compete for substantial prize pools. In recent years, the tournament’s prize pool has surpassed $40 million, emphasizing its significance. Fans can expect intense competition and strategic brilliance from sought-after teams like OG and PSG.LGD.

League of Legends World Championship

The League of Legends World Championship captivates millions with its high-stakes gameplay and riveting narratives. As a pinnacle event for League of Legends, it attracts top teams from various regional leagues. In 2022, it boasted peak concurrent views of over 44 million. The 2024 championship aims to raise the bar with thrilling matches and electrifying moments.

Fortnite World Cup

The Fortnite World Cup showcases the creativity and skill inherent in Fortnite’s dynamic gameplay. Top players from around the world compete in building and battling for significant cash prizes. Previous editions have seen players like Bugha rise to stardom, and 2024 promises to be no different, with immersive competitions and engaging battles.

IEM Katowice

IEM Katowice is a leading event for Counter-Strike: Global Offensive (CS: GO) fans. The tournament, known for its competitive intensity, features renowned CS: GO talent. Held in Poland, it draws a passionate audience eager to witness tactical prowess and exceptional gameplay. IEM Katowice’s history of high stakes and epic moments makes it an unmissable event.

Overwatch League Grand Finals

The Overwatch League Grand Finals present the climax of the Overwatch competitive season. It features top teams vying for glory and a share of lucrative prize money. Known for its fast-paced, strategy-driven gameplay, the 2024 edition expects to continue the tradition of delivering thrilling finales and memorable plays from elite teams.

Valorant Champions Tour

The Valorant Champions Tour is quickly becoming a must-watch event. Launched by Riot Games, it’s designed to create a competitive ecosystem for Valorant enthusiasts worldwide.

This tour combines regional events and culminates in an international championship. In 2023, the tournament recorded a peak viewership of over 1 million, showcasing its growing popularity.

The unique strategic gameplay in Valorant, with distinct agent abilities, sets it apart, attracting both seasoned players and newcomers. Given its recent rise, the 2024 tour is expected to feature even more intense matches and a diverse mix of global talent.

Call of Duty League

For fans of first-person shooters, the Call of Duty League offers a thrilling competitive experience. Since its inception, the league has evolved to include a franchise model, ensuring professional teams have consistent backing and infrastructure.

In 2023, they introduced major format changes that increased audience engagement, reaching viewership highs during playoffs and finals.

The league’s mix of legendary veterans and rising stars keeps every match unpredictable and exciting. With innovations in gameplay and team dynamics in 2024, the Call of Duty League promises to maintain its position as a top-tier esports competition.
